The purpose of the Firewall Platform Engineer position is to ensure the security, reliability, and compliance of the company's network by operating, enhancing, and governing enterprise firewall platforms. This role protects the organization's infrastructure from threats by administering firewall technologies, analyzing and optimizing security controls, and automating operational workflows. The engineer helps establish and enforce network security standards, supports incident response, and enables secure business connectivity across data center, cloud, and partner environments.

Firewall & Network Security Operations
Administer and maintain next?generation firewalls (e.g., Palo Alto, Cisco ASA, Checkpoint, SonicWall).
Monitor, troubleshoot, and optimize firewall policies, NAT rules, routing, and security controls.
Conduct firewall compliance reviews, rule audits, and cleanup using tools such as Algosec, Panorama, or built?in vendor tools.
Analyze network traffic, netflow, and IDS/IPS events to identify anomalies and potential threats.
Security Engineering & Automation
Develop scripts or automation workflows to streamline firewall operations, policy deployment, and validation.
Assist in the design and implementation of new firewall platform capabilities, including segmentation, cloud connectivity, and zero-trust initiatives.
Support vulnerability remediation, configuration hardening, and alignment with corporate security standards.
Security Governance & Compliance
Ensure firewall and network security controls align with internal policies and industry frameworks (HIPAA, HITRUST, NIST CSF, etc.).
Collaborate with audit, compliance, and risk stakeholders to provide evidence, documentation, and remediation steps.
Maintain accurate configuration documentation, change records, and operational runbooks.
Cross?Team Collaboration
Partner with network engineering, SOC, endpoint security, and cloud teams to maintain holistic defense of the enterprise environment.
Participate in incident response efforts by analyzing network activity and implementing containment changes.
Provide subject-matter support for projects requiring secure connectivity across data centers, cloud environments, and partner networks.
Morning: Monitoring, Reviews, and Daily Hygiene
- Start by reviewing alerts, changes, and overnight activity on the firewall platforms.
- Check for anomalies in traffic flows, policy hits, or automated compliance reports.
- Respond to requests from the SOC or security operations regarding suspicious traffic or containment rules.
Mid Morning: Operational Work & Ticket Queue
- Work through firewall change requests: new rules, rule modifications, connectivity troubleshooting, or policy cleanups.
- Investigate and resolve tickets related to access failures, segmentation issues, or platform performance.
- Use tools like Wireshark, Panorama, Algosec, or vendor consoles to validate behavior or optimize rules.
Midday: Collaboration & Project Work
- Meet with network engineering, cloud teams, or application owners to plan secure network designs for upcoming projects.
- Participate in cross team architecture reviews or security governance discussions.
- Provide firewall guidance for data center migrations, cloud onboarding, or new business partnerships.
Afternoon: Engineering and Continuous Improvement
- Work on automation scripts or workflows to streamline firewall operations (policy reviews, rule pushes, reporting).
- Update documentation, runbooks, and topology diagrams.
- Conduct firewall audits or cleanups to improve performance, reduce risk, and align with standards like HIPAA/HITRUST.
- Develop and test new configurations, features, or platform enhancements in lab or test environments.
Throughout the Day: Incident & Support Responsiveness
- Assist the SOC or Threat Response team during active investigations, performing traffic analysis or implementing blocks.
- Provide expert troubleshooting for network issues where firewalls are part of the path.
- Collaborate with compliance or audit teams to supply evidence and ensure configuration accuracy.
End of Day: Planning and Wrap Up
- Review change windows, upcoming maintenance, and platform health metrics.
- Prepare for scheduled deployments or rule pushes.
- Identify areas for improvement and propose solutions for better security controls or operational efficiency.
